In the recent announcement of JEE Mains 2024 results, DAV Bistupur students have exhibited exceptional performance, with 38 of them scoring remarkably well. The results were declared late Wednesday night, following the conclusion of the session-two exams.
JAMSHEDPUR – A notable achievement was recorded by the students of DAV Bistupur in the latest JEE Mains 2024 examination, with a remarkable number of students scoring high. The top scorer among them, Anuj Ranjan, achieved a near-perfect score of 99.7 NTA score, setting a high benchmark for his peers.
Individual Achievements
Notable among the achievers are Aryan Kumar Chaudhary and Debashish Paul, who scored 99.62 and 99.6 respectively, showcasing their academic prowess. Further down the list, students like Priyanshu Ghosh and Nipun Shekhar continued the trend with scores of 99.3 and 99.21. Each student’s performance highlights the rigorous preparation and dedication towards their studies.

Normalized Scores
The NTA, responsible for conducting the JEE Mains, has explained that these scores are normalized based on the relative performance of all exam participants in a session, providing a fair comparison across different test dates. Meanwhile, Priyansh Pranjal from Ranchi topped the state with a score of 99.88, having improved significantly from his first session score.
Overall, this year’s JEE Main saw an increase in top scorers, with 56 candidates nationally achieving a perfect 100 NTA score, up from last year’s 43. This includes a notable performance from various states with Telangana leading the count.
